Finding the Right Small Chaise Sofa For Your Home
Knowing what you want and want from a compact chaise sofa is the first step towards finding it. This way, you can compare multiple models to make a smart choice.
For example, if you're likely to move in the future, consider modular sectionals with a reversible chaise that can switch from left to right side. This allows you to adapt to changing room layouts.
Comfort
If you're looking for a sofa that will enhance your relaxation to the next level then a chaise sectional may be the perfect option. Chaises are built to accommodate sitting, which makes them perfect for sunrooms and reading nooks. They are also ideal for living spaces and entertainment areas, since they provide additional seating for parties or family movie night.
When you are choosing a chaise sectional make sure that it is made with robust materials and a sturdy construction. Choose a frame made of solid wood--preferably kiln-dried wood--and a sturdy back and seat cushion that you can sit in for long periods of time. A lot of small chaise sectionals are modular and allow the chaise lounge to be moved from left to right in accordance with the space. You should consider a reversible option, such as our top choice Albany Park Kova, for maximum flexibility.

Style
A sofa with chaise is a hybrid of two sofas and a couch. However, it's important to know that a couch with a chaise differs from a standard sofa. While a sofa is intended to be sat on in a straight position A chaise lounge is designed to be a place for relaxation and is designed to be used in a more reclined position.
The sofa-with-chaise is a popular sectional choice due to a variety of reasons, such as its flexibility and comfort. This type of sofa is ideal for all rooms. It can be utilized in sunrooms, reading nooks or as a part of the larger sectional. It's also great for open spaces since it doesn't require corners.
There are many styles of sofas that have built-in chaises, ranging from the traditional to the modern. Generally, they have a slim form and minimal detailing, but the texture of the fabric provides warmth and a unique look. If you are seeking a small, compact sofa with straight lines and track arms, go for a reversible item. This modern design will give your space an elegant, clean appearance and is compatible with many decor styles.
Sectionals with chaises are perfect for small homes and apartments because they require less floor space. This allows you to increase the seating space. There are many options that can be made modular to fit other pieces from the collection. This gives you the ability to extend your seating area and add a storage or bed when needed.
To determine if a tiny chaise couch is the best choice for your living space, you can take measurements and sketch a layout of your furniture. If you can, sit on a sofa and test the comfort of it. Select the material or color that best fits your style.
Selecting a fabric is a big choice because it will influence the overall look of your sofa. Certain fabrics are more durable or resistant to staining. In addition, some fabrics is more adaptable and can be used with a variety of colors and patterns. For example, a grey sectional can be paired with throw pillows or accent blankets in a variety different textures and shades to create an eclectic but unified design.

Stores
A sofa chaise adds the luxury of your living space by providing an extra spot for families to kick back and relax. You can find them as a long chair that stands alone even though the majority of modern sectionals include an extra chaise in the corner. The sofa chaise provides an unique seating alternative to a conventional couch. It lets you lie on your back, half-reclining. This is a great option for families who wish to get together and watch television, but also for individuals who like to read or nap upright.
You can find small chaise sofas that come in a variety of styles and fabrics that will fit your decor. Some are constructed with sturdy, easy to clean materials that are resistant to staining and repel pet hair. Others are designed with slipcovers that are removable, making it simple to clean the cushions. Choose upholstery that comes in a wide range of patterns and colors from bright jewel tones to neutral. Some upholstery options also feature weaves that feel and look just like velvet but without the need for maintenance.
Whatever material you choose, it's crucial to select a chaise with a sturdy wooden frame. If you can, select a sofa made of kiln dried wood. This kind of frame is more stable and has a greater weight capacity than one made from press-bent wood or particle board.
If you're shopping for a small sectional sofa that has a chaise, think about modular designs that let you move the pieces around to meet changing needs or simply change the style of your room. For instance, this reversible modular sectional from Joss and Main includes a chaise seater that conveniently converts into a queen-sized sleeper.
You can also find chaise sofas that come with built-in storage to store blankets, pillows and other things. This Furniture Of America Stacy sofa features an extra cubby underneath the seat cushions, where you can stash items out of sight.
